There are many moving parts involved in the operation of your BMW car or SAV, and most depend on belts, hoses, or both to perform their roles properly. Belts move parts, while hoses deliver liquids that cool or lubricate them.

The Types of Belts

There are three, excluding the seat belts inside your cabin. A timing belt helps the crankshaft and engine camshaft operate in sync while also helping to prevent parts from hitting each other. If it goes bad, you'll know immediately since your engine will stop operating. Some newer models may have a timing chain rather than a timing belt, though.

Serpentine belts and drive belts are responsible for moving everything from the alternator to your power steering, water pump, and HVAC system.

What Hoses Do

Hoses direct liquids to and from parts. Examples include your radiator, which uses hoses to route coolant to and from the engine, and the fuel hoses that connect the gas tank to the engine.

How to Spot Bad Belts and Hoses

Over time, though, even the best belts and hoses can fail. Signs of trouble include:

  • Very loose or slack belts
  • Belts that are too tight to turn
  • Cracked hoses
  • Fraying belt edges
  • Large pools of liquid gathered under your vehicle
